Работа с Microsoft Excel начинается с умения выделять данные — будь то одна ячейка, целый столбец или разрозненные фрагменты таблицы. Казалось бы, что может быть проще? Но даже опытные пользователи иногда теряются, когда нужно выбрать несмежные диапазоны или зафиксировать выделение при прокрутке. Эта статья раскроет все нюансы: от базовых приёмов с мышью до профессиональных комбинаций клавиш, которые сэкономят вам часы работы.
Мы разберём не только стандартные способы (вроде удержания Ctrl или Shift), но и малоизвестные фишки — например, как выделить все ячейки с формулами или только видимые строки после фильтрации. Особое внимание уделим типичным ошибкам, из-за которых выделение сбивается, и научимся их избегать. Готовы перестать тратить время на рутинные клики?
Базовые способы выделения ячеек мышью
Начнём с азов: как выделить несколько ячеек, строк или столбцов с помощью мыши. Эти методы работают во всех версиях Excel (от 2010 до 365) и подходят для большинства задач.
Чтобы выбрать смежный диапазон (соседние ячейки), достаточно:
- 🖱️ Кликнуть левой кнопкой мыши на первую ячейку диапазона.
- 🔄 Удерживая кнопку, протянуть курсор до последней ячейки.
- 📋 Отпустить кнопку — выделение готово.
Для выделения целиком строки или столбца используйте их заголовки (буквы для столбцов, цифры для строк). Например, клик по заголовку A выделит весь столбец A, а по цифре 5 — всю пятую строку. Чтобы выбрать несколько строк/столбцов подряд, протяните курсор по их заголовкам.
Если нужно выделить всю таблицу, кликните по серому треугольнику в левом верхнем углу (между заголовком строки 1 и столбца A). Этот приём срабатывает и для выделения всех данных на листе, если они не прерываются пустыми строками/столбцами.
Горячие клавиши для быстрого выделения
Клавиатурные комбинации ускоряют работу в Excel в разы. Вот самые полезные сочетания для выделения:
| Комбинация клавиш | Действие | Пример использования |
|---|---|---|
Shift + Стрелки |
Расширяет выделение на одну ячейку в направлении стрелки | Выделить диапазон A1:B5, начиная с A1 |
Ctrl + Shift + Стрелка |
Выделяет диапазон до последней заполненной ячейки в направлении стрелки | Быстро выбрать все данные в столбце C до первой пустой ячейки |
Ctrl + A (дважды) |
Выделить все ячейки на листе (первый клик — текущий диапазон, второй — весь лист) | Подготовка к копированию всей таблицы |
Shift + Пробел |
Выделить всю строку | Копирование или удаление строки целиком |
Ctrl + Пробел |
Выделить весь столбец | Применение формата ко всему столбцу |
Комбинация Ctrl + Shift + * (звёздочка на цифровой клавиатуре) выделяет текущую область данных вокруг активной ячейки — это удобно для работы с таблицами, окружёнными пустыми строками/столбцами. Например, если курсор стоит в ячейке D10, а данные расположены в диапазоне B2:F20, эта комбинация выделит именно этот диапазон, игнорируя пустые ячейки.
Выделение несмежных диапазонов
Часто требуется выбрать несколько разрозненных ячеек или диапазонов — например, для одновременного форматирования или копирования. Здесь на помощь приходит клавиша Ctrl.
Алгоритм простой:
- Выделите первый диапазон (например,
A1:B5). - Зажмите
Ctrlи, не отпуская её, выделите следующий диапазон (например,D10:E15). - Повторяйте шаг 2 для всех нужных фрагментов.
Чтобы отменить выделение одного из диапазонов, снова зажмите Ctrl и кликните по нему. Этот метод работает и для отдельных ячеек, и для целых строк/столбцов. Например, можно выбрать столбцы A, C и E, удерживая Ctrl при кликах по их заголовкам.
Убедитесь, что клавиша Num Lock выключена (иначе Ctrl+Стрелки не сработают)|Проверьте, не активен ли режим "Разметка страницы" (в нём горячие клавиши могут вести себя иначе)|Отмените предыдущее выделение (кликните по любой ячейке), чтобы избежать наложений-->
⚠️ Внимание: Если после выделения несмежных диапазонов вы пытаетесь ввести данные или формулу, Excel автоматически применит их только к первой выделенной ячейке. Чтобы заполнить все выбранные ячейки, нажмите Ctrl + Enter после ввода.
Продвинутые приёмы: выделение по условиям
Иногда нужно выделить ячейки, соответствующие определённым критериям — например, все отрицательные числа или ячейки с формулами. Для этого в Excel есть инструмент "Найти и выделить" (Главная → Найти и выделить → Выделить группу ячеек).
Рассмотрим популярные сценарии:
- 📊 Ячейки с формулами: Выберите
Формулыв окне "Выделение группы ячеек". Это полезно, если нужно скопировать только вычисления, а не значения. - 🔢 Числовые значения: Опция
Постоянные значениявыделит ячейки без формул (только ручной ввод). - 🎨 Условное форматирование: Выберите
Условные форматы, чтобы работать только с ячейками, к которым применены правила форматирования. - 🔍 Пустые ячейки: Опция
Пустые ячейкипоможет быстро найти и заполнить пропуски.
Ещё один мощный инструмент — фильтр. Если данные отфильтрованы, выделение клавишами Ctrl + A или мышью затронет только видимые ячейки. Это удобно для копирования отфильтрованных строк без скрытых данных. Например, если вы применили фильтр по значению "Да" в столбце B, то выделение диапазона A1:C100 и копирование (Ctrl + C) скопирует только строки, где в столбце B стоит "Да".
Как выделить ячейки с ошибками формул
В окне "Найти и выделить" выберите "Формулы", затем поставьте галочку "Ошибки". Это выделит все ячейки с #ДЕЛ/0!, #ЗНАЧ! и другими ошибками.
Выделение с помощью имени диапазона
Если вы часто работаете с одними и теми же диапазонами, присвойте им имена. Это сэкономит время и уменьшит риск ошибок. Например, диапазон B2:D20 можно назвать Продажи_2026.
Как это сделать:
- Выделите нужный диапазон (например,
B2:D20). - В поле "Имя" (слева от строки формул) введите название (например,
Отчёт_Квартал1). - Нажмите
Enter.
Теперь, чтобы выделить этот диапазон, достаточно:
- 🔠 Нажать
F5, ввести имя и нажатьOK. - 📝 Или выбрать имя из выпадающего списка в поле "Имя".
Именованные диапазоны удобны для:
- 📈 Быстрого перехода к часто используемым данным.
- 🔄 Создания динамических формул (например,
=СУММ(Отчёт_Квартал1)). - 🖼️ Использования в сводных таблицах как источников данных.
⚠️ Внимание: Имена диапазонов чувствительны к регистру!Продажиипродажи— это два разных имени. Также избегайте пробелов (используйте подчёркивание) и не начинайте имя с цифры.
Типичные ошибки и как их избежать
Даже простые операции с выделением могут пойти не так. Вот самые распространённые проблемы и их решения:
| Проблема | Причина | Решение |
|---|---|---|
| Выделение сбивается при прокрутке | Активна опция "Разрешить маркер заполнения и перетаскивание ячеек" | Отключите её в Файл → Параметры → Дополнительно |
| Нельзя выделить несмежные диапазоны | Включён режим "Разметка страницы" | Переключитесь на вид "Обычный" (Вид → Обычный) |
Клавиши Shift + Стрелка не работают |
Активна клавиша Scroll Lock |
Отключите Scroll Lock (индикатор на клавиатуре) |
Выделяются лишние ячейки при Ctrl + A |
На листе есть скрытые строки/столбцы | Покажите все данные (Главная → Формат → Отобразить) |
Ещё одна частая ошибка — выделение не тех данных при фильтрации. Например, вы отфильтровали таблицу, но при копировании (Ctrl + C) в буфер попадают и скрытые строки. Чтобы этого избежать:
- 🔍 Убедитесь, что курсор стоит в видимой ячейке.
- 📋 Используйте
Alt + ;(выделяет только видимые ячейки текущего диапазона). - 🔄 Или выделите вручную только видимые строки, удерживая
Shift.
Полезные надстройки и макросы для выделения
Если стандартных инструментов Excel недостаточно, автоматизируйте процесс с помощью макросов или надстроек. Например, макрос для выделения всех ячеек с определённым цветом:
Sub ВыделитьПоЦвету()
Dim rng As Range, cell As Range
Dim targetColor As Long
targetColor = RGB(255, 200, 150) ' Задайте нужный цвет
For Each cell In Selection
If cell.Interior.Color = targetColor Then
If rng Is Nothing Then
Set rng = cell
Else
Set rng = Union(rng, cell)
End If
End If
Next cell
If Not rng Is Nothing Then rng.Select
End Sub
Для работы с макросами:
- Нажмите
Alt + F11, чтобы открыть редактор VBA. - Вставьте код в новый модуль (
Insert → Module). - Запустите макрос (
F5) после выделения диапазона для поиска.
Популярные надстройки для расширенного выделения:
- 🛠️ Kutools for Excel: Инструмент "Выделить ячейки с дубликатами" или "Выделить пустые/непустые ячейки".
- 📊 Ablebits: Функции выделения по нескольким условиям (например, текст + цвет).
- 🔍 ASAP Utilities: Быстрое выделение ячеек с формулами, комментариями или гиперссылками.
Прежде чем устанавливать надстройки, проверьте их совместимость с вашей версией Excel (особенно если используете Excel 2016 или старше).
FAQ: Ответы на частые вопросы
Можно ли выделить ячейки в защищённом листе?
Да, но только если при защите листа (Рецензирование → Защитить лист) была разрешена опция "Выделение заблокированных ячеек". Если эта опция отключена, выделить можно только разблокированные ячейки (их статус задаётся в Формат ячеек → Защита).
Как выделить все ячейки с гиперссылками?
Используйте инструмент "Найти и выделить":
- Нажмите
Ctrl + F(илиГлавная → Найти и выделить → Найти). - В поле "Найти" введите
.(это шаблон для гиперссылок). - Нажмите "Найти все", затем
Ctrl + Aв окне результатов.
Все ячейки с гиперссылками будут выделены.
Почему при выделении несмежных диапазонов некоторые ячейки пропадают из выделения?
Это происходит, если:
- Вы случайно кликнули по выделенной области без
Ctrl. - Активна опция "Перетаскивание и копирование ячеек" (
Файл → Параметры → Дополнительно). - Лист защищён, и выделение части ячеек запрещено.
Решение: отмените действие (Ctrl + Z) и повторите выделение, удерживая Ctrl.
Как выделить диапазон, который больше видимой области экрана?
Есть несколько способов:
- Используйте клавиши:
Ctrl + Shift + Стрелка вниз(выделит до последней заполненной ячейки в столбце). - Введите адрес диапазона вручную в поле "Имя" (например,
A1:Z1000) и нажмитеEnter. - Перейдите в режим "Полный экран" (
Вид → Режим полного экрана), чтобы увидеть больше ячеек.
Можно ли выделить ячейки на разных листах одновременно?
Нет, Excel не поддерживает выделение ячеек на нескольких листах одновременно. Однако можно:
- Выделить одинаковые диапазоны на разных листах, удерживая
Ctrlи кликая по их ярлычкам. - Использовать макрос для группового выделения (требуются знания VBA).
- Скопировать данные на один лист, выполнить действия, затем разнести обратно.